    LA Pool build

    The infinity catch pool is very clean. We have the usual debris as it acts as a large skimmer. We also have a separate filtration system for it which helps. I brush it every 5 days and that seems to work fine. No leaves as everything we have is evergreen. Maintenance free at the moment.

  14. S

    LA Pool build

    The tree is a ficus. The wall has been built with a pvc root barrier and reinforced concrete and damp course protection. We plan to keep the trees trimmed at 8ft with a 3ft width. We love the blackies tile. Tony. Thanks for the kind words.
